功能点计算方法功能点概述1功能点计算3功能点分析2功能点概述1IFPUG起源IFPUG起源1979IBM提出需求:以一种独立于计算机语言的方法来评估软件开发成果20世纪80年代初,正式的FP使用指南发布20世纪80年代末,(FunctionPoints)是度量软件规模的一个标准度量单元一个软件的大小可以通过交付给用户的功能点数来度量,成为一种国际标准。在软件度量中广泛应用,将系统分解成更小的模块,便于理解和分析为项目范围、工作量、资源、时间等因素进行估算提供了依据FP与LOC的区别常见的方法FP功能点法LOC代码行估算时间FP法常用在项目开始或项目需求基本明确时使用,估算的结果准确性较高而使用LOC代码行估算法则误差较大开发技术相关性使用FP法无需懂得软件的开发技术LOC法则与开发技术密切相关估算角度FP法以用户为角度进行估算LOC法则以技术为角度进行估算FP的特点简单快速、甲方易理解、可开展行业比对、完整估算方案、有明确定义:存在多个兼容的国际标准、不同的估算者误差在10%以内,有利于:需求分析、需求管理、绩效评价。给我们一种视角来审视项目。FP的适用范围功能点:国际最流行的规模度量方法功能点成功应用:从固定价格改为按功能点付费哪些软件适用:以数据和交互处理为中心的;以功能多少为主要工作量和造价制约因素。例如:电子政务、银行、电信、办公自动化等开发技术相关性不合用的软件:数据处理过程复杂、创意型软件、对性能或质量有特殊要求的,例如:杀毒软件、网络游戏、航空航天软件、视频和图形处理软件功能点标准概述
功能点计算方法 来自淘豆网m.daumloan.com转载请标明出处.